首先講一下java的基本知識.JAVA是一種易移植和平臺無關(guān)行的程序.因?yàn)橐獙?shí)現(xiàn)平臺無關(guān)性所以就必須在各個(gè)不同的平臺上使用虛擬機(jī),使虛擬機(jī)完成和底端硬件的交互同時(shí)虛擬機(jī)給java程序提供統(tǒng)一的接口使得java程序可以不考慮底端的運(yùn)行.也因?yàn)槭沁@個(gè)原因java不能直接運(yùn)行在底端硬件上所以造成了很多不足,比如運(yùn)行效率低,占用內(nèi)存大等問題.至于兼容性是和jvm直接相關(guān)(許多朋友抱怨opera的兼容性有問題,其實(shí)主要問題是出在ibmjvm和硬件的兼容性上其次就是出在和opera的軟件交互上,因?yàn)閛pera的其他版本都是由同一個(gè)代碼工程生成,而opera在其他平臺上運(yùn)行都很穩(wěn)定)
下載IBM的JAVA虛擬機(jī)(jvm)和opera的最新版,可到http://www.opera.com/products/mobile/operamini/phones/?ph 中下載,其中有jvm的下載鏈接(完成簡單注冊即可下載).
分別安裝opera和jvm(安裝WEME571JVM\JVM\ARM4T既可).
安裝完成之后進(jìn)入手機(jī)控制臺,在其他項(xiàng)中會(huì)出現(xiàn)一個(gè)"IBM Java VM",進(jìn)入其中打開雙緩存,設(shè)置代理"10.0.0.172:80".此時(shí)java設(shè)置完成,即可運(yùn)行opera.
PS:為保證java能順利運(yùn)行建議可以在"IBM Java VM"中加大內(nèi)存量和堆棧量(這樣可以為java更大的運(yùn)行空間)
安裝java程序:將.jar文件拷入卡中用RescoExplorer找到.jar文件,單擊它,此時(shí)可以看到屏幕一閃,再打開"IBM Java VM"(此"IBM Java VM"是在菜單中的執(zhí)行項(xiàng),而不是上文提到的),此時(shí)便可自動(dòng)安裝.
PS:因現(xiàn)在JVM對java的支持性不好所以裝上的java程序往往會(huì)嚴(yán)重失真或者無法運(yùn)行(這也是讓我很郁悶的地方,我本人就是搞Java開發(fā)的,本想測一下自己開發(fā)的幾個(gè)程序,結(jié)果....唉!還是用模擬器吧..),所以引用前輩的話"能不用java就不要用java了,找其他程序代替吧"!
----本人于上周才入手的Treo650,首次接觸palm,在此期間得到了眾多人的幫助,在此表示無限感激.